[4/9] batman-adv: remove hash resize functions
Commit Message
Signed-off-by: Marek Lindner <lindner_marek@yahoo.de>
---
batman-adv/hash.h | 38 --------------------------------------
batman-adv/originator.c | 14 +-------------
batman-adv/translation-table.c | 32 ++------------------------------
3 files changed, 3 insertions(+), 81 deletions(-)
